"Tony Lux, recently retired as superintendent of the Merrillville Community public schools, has written a blistering opinion article in the Fort Wayne Journal-Gazette. He says that it is time for all supporters of public education to unite and vote for legislators who support public education. The only way to stop the total destruction of public education in the great state of Indiana is to vote for legislators who will support public schools against the entrepreneurs, privatizers, and profiteers....the election of 2014 may be the most important ever for the future of public education in Indiana." .."Now is the time to step up and support those who will fund our public schools and oust those vandals who would destroy them and turn our children into profit centers."
